Transaction 650d04b50dbec0494108c920b3797bd3b8c417a26563bcd0da17aa02a7523af6
1 Input
1 Output
-
650d04b50dbec0494108c920b3797bd3b8c417a26563bcd0da17aa02a7523af6:0
- value
- 2759602261
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ff18af5aa8b142caf43cd5ccdfdb3e5a13f0361
- address
- bc1q8lcc4ad23v2zet6re4wvmldnuksn7qmphrnn52